Sculptured By Natural Elements

1 year, 8 months

I stumbled upon this amazing rock formation in a remote location in Zion National Park. I took several shots of this formation in different locations, but I think this one really tells the story on how it was formed in time. Gear used: Canon 6D Mark II, Sigma 24-105 ART, Manfroto tripod. Camera settings: Manual exposure RAW, ISO-100, aperture setting F10 @ 1/80 second. Edited in Lightroom>Photoshop.
